Advertisement

微信小程序通过audio组件提供音乐播放功能,并附带源码下载。

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
本文详细阐述了如何利用微信小程序中的 audio 组件来实现播放音乐的功能。为了方便广大开发者学习和应用,现将具体实现过程分享如下:首先,我们来展示一下最终的音乐播放效果。其次,接下来将重点介绍关键代码部分:① 在 index.wxml 文件中,音频元素的配置如下:<audio src=”{{audioSrc}}” poster=”{{audioPoster}}” name=”{{audioName}}” author=”{{audioAuthor}}” controls></audio> ② 在 index.js 文件中,页面的数据配置包含音频海报的 URL 地址:data: { audioPoster: http://y.gtimg.cn/music/photo_new/T002R300x300M000003rs }。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• 实例详解【含
    优质
    本教程详细讲解了如何在微信小程序中使用音频组件来实现音乐播放功能,并提供完整的源代码供读者参考和学习。 本段落实例讲述了微信小程序使用audio组件播放音乐功能。分享给大家供大家参考: 1. 效果展示 2. 关键代码 ① index.wxml ```html ``` ② index.js Page({ data: { audioPoster: http://y.gtimg.cn/music/photo_new/T002R300x300M000003rs, } })
  • 优质
    这款微信小程序音乐播放器提供便捷流畅的在线听歌体验,支持歌曲搜索、收藏及分享功能。轻松下载,畅享音乐世界! 【音乐播放器微信小程序开发详解】在移动互联网时代,由于其无需安装、即用即走的特点,微信小程序受到了众多开发者和企业的青睐。本段落将深入探讨如何开发一款音乐播放器的微信小程序,涵盖核心功能、技术实现以及设计原则。 一、小程序概述 微信小程序是由腾讯公司推出的一种轻量级应用形式。它结合了网页与原生应用程序的优点,在不离开微信环境的情况下为用户提供便捷的服务体验。音乐播放器的微信小程序就是利用该平台提供在线听歌服务,包括搜索歌曲和管理播放列表等功能的应用程序。 二、开发工具及语言 要开发此类小程序,首先需要安装并使用官方提供的微信开发者工具来完成代码编写、预览调试以及发布等操作。此外,还需要掌握WXML(微信小程序标记语言)和WXSS(样式表语言),同时熟悉JavaScript及其在微信平台上的API库。 三、界面设计与布局 音乐播放器的设计应以用户体验为中心,并确保易用性。常见的元素包括控制面板区域(如播放/暂停按钮等)、歌曲列表显示区、搜索栏以及推荐歌单部分。建议采用简洁明了的布局策略,通过使用微信小程序支持的Flexbox弹性盒模型来灵活调整各个组件的位置和大小。 四、音乐播放功能实现 1. 播放控制:利用audio组件可以轻松实现在微信内部进行音频文件的基本操作(如开始/停止等)。 2. 加载与缓冲处理:通过监听onLoad及onProgress事件确保流畅的听歌体验。 3. 调整进度条位置:可以通过设置currentTime属性来实现手动拖动调整播放位置的功能。 4. 切换播放模式:支持顺序、随机和单曲循环等不同的播放方式,这些功能可通过修改相应的API参数轻松完成。 五、歌曲列表与管理 1. 获取音乐信息:可以从服务器端获取到包括歌名、歌手名称及专辑封面在内的详细数据,并将其存储在本地缓存或利用wx.setStorageSync方法进行保存。 2. 添加/删除歌曲:允许用户添加自己喜欢的曲目或者从播放清单中移除不需要的内容,这涉及到对数据结构的操作。 3. 排序功能:根据用户的偏好或是加入时间来重新排列播放列表。 六、搜索与推荐 实现音乐搜索需要对接第三方提供的API接口(如QQ音乐等),通过关键词查询并展示相关结果。此外还可以利用算法分析用户行为以提供个性化歌单推荐服务,这通常涉及到后台数据处理和智能计算技术的应用。 七、社交分享集成 为了增加小程序的可见度及用户的参与感,在其中加入微信登录功能是非常必要的;同时也可以整合朋友圈或聊天消息中的分享按钮来促进传播效果。 八、性能优化与适配性调整 在开发过程中,需要关注内存使用量和网络请求效率,并针对不同设备屏幕大小进行相应的界面自适应处理。通过合理的架构设计和技术选型可以确保应用的稳定性和高效运行。 总结而言,在构建一个音乐播放器微信小程序时,除了要精通前端技术之外还需要深入了解音乐服务平台的相关业务逻辑及用户需求分析等方面的知识。最终的目标是开发出具备完整功能并具有良好用户体验的应用程序。作为参考案例之一,“QQ音乐”是一个值得学习和借鉴的成功范例。
  • 中的
    优质
    微信小程序中的音乐播放组件是一种方便用户在小程序内直接播放音乐的功能模块。通过集成该组件,开发者能够轻松实现音频文件的播放、暂停、停止等操作,并为用户提供直观的操作界面和良好的交互体验。 使用createInnerAudioContext实现的播放组件可以支持播放进度显示和倒计时功能。
  • 优质
    这是一款便捷的音乐播放器微信小程序源代码,内置丰富功能,如歌曲搜索、播放列表管理等,方便开发者快速搭建个性化的在线音频应用。 微信小程序-音乐播放器源码提供了一套完整的代码实现方案,帮助开发者快速搭建一个功能完善的音乐播放应用。该源码包含了基本的歌曲列表展示、搜索功能以及播放控制等核心模块,并且在用户体验方面进行了优化设计。对于希望学习或直接使用现成解决方案来开发类似项目的个人和团队来说,这是一个非常有价值的资源。
  • .zip
    优质
    这段资料提供了一个名为“微信小程序音乐播放器”的项目源代码下载。此代码库适用于开发者学习并构建个人或商业用途的音乐播放功能于微信小程序中。 微信小程序音乐播放器.zip 学习使用。
  • 器-
    优质
    这是一款便捷的音乐播放器微信小程序,提供丰富的歌曲资源和流畅的播放体验。用户可以轻松搜索、收藏喜爱的音乐,随时随地享受美妙旋律。 微信小程序 - 音乐播放器是一款方便用户在手机上轻松听音乐的应用程序。它提供了丰富的歌曲资源,并支持个性化歌单创建、歌词同步显示等功能,为用户提供流畅的音乐体验。此外,该应用还具备良好的界面设计和操作便捷性,让用户可以快速找到喜欢的歌曲并享受高质量的音频效果。
  • 优质
    简介:这是一款简洁实用的微信小程序音乐播放器,提供丰富的曲库资源和个性化的推荐功能。用户可以轻松搜索歌曲、创建歌单,并与好友分享喜欢的音乐。 微信小程序:音乐播放器的歌曲资源来源于百度音乐。TODO:实现收藏列表切换上一曲/下一曲功能。
  • 器-
    优质
    这是一款便捷的音乐播放器微信小程序,用户可以轻松搜索、试听和下载喜爱的歌曲。界面简洁操作流畅,提供个性化的音乐推荐服务,让美妙旋律触手可及。 微信小程序音乐播放器DEMO适用于初学者,帮助快速了解小程序。
  • 器-
    优质
    这是一款便捷实用的音乐播放器微信小程序,汇集海量曲库资源,支持个性化歌单创建和分享。界面简洁流畅,操作轻松上手,随时随地享受音乐带来的无限乐趣。 微信小程序音乐播放器可以免费下载使用。
  • 优质
    微信小程序音乐播放器是一款便捷的在线音频应用,用户可以轻松浏览、播放及管理喜爱的音乐作品,享受高品质无广告干扰的听歌体验。 音乐播放器是一款微信小程序应用程序。